Kitchen Cabinet Staining in Dayton, OH
Kitchen cabinet staining services involve applying a durable, attractive finish to existing cabinets to enhance their appearance and update their style. This process typically includes preparing the cabinet surfaces, applying stain or color to achieve a desired shade, and sealing the finish to ensure longevity. Projects can range from restoring worn or outdated cabinets to changing the color of existing woodwork for a fresh look, making it a popular choice for homeowners seeking to refresh their kitchens without a full remodel.
Property owners interested in cabinet staining should consider factors such as the current condition of the cabinets, the type of wood, and the desired color or finish. It is important to understand that staining can highlight the natural grain of the wood or provide a uniform color, depending on the technique used. Before requesting this service, homeowners often want to know about the preparation process, the types of finishes available, and how the final results will complement their kitchen’s overall style.
